Dover to return to traditional Town Meeting day


Not a lucky day: A tow truck pulls a town of Dover plow truck out of the ditch on Friday, January 13. Ice caused it to slide off the road. Mark Sprague

DOVER- Selectboard members voted to warn this year’s Town Meeting for Tuesday, March 7, a return to traditional Town Meeting day following two years of pandemic-related postponements.  
The board also set Wednesday, March 1, at 6 pm as the date for their public informational meeting to discuss warned articles and proposed budgets.  
Both meetings will take place at Dover Town Hall, another return to the pre-pandemic norm.
